About Dr Christopher Blair
Dr. Christopher Blair is a distinguished Neurologist with a passion for advancing neurological medicine and patient education. Graduating with First Class Honours in Medicine from the University of Sydney in 2013, Dr Blair is a dynamic force in the field of neuroscience. Dr Blair earned First Class Honours in neuroscience from the University of Nottingham and later completed a DPhil (PhD) in behavioural neuroscience from the University of York in the UK. His academic journey further expanded with two Postdoctoral Research Fellowships, one in behavioural neuroscience and the other in mesenchymal stem cell therapies. These fellowships took him to prestigious institutions like the Victor Chang Research Institute (Sydney) and Mater Medical Research Institute (Brisbane). Dr Blair has gained invaluable clinical experience at Royal Prince Alfred and Liverpool Hospitals, honing his skills in the treatment of diverse neurological disorders. His subspecialty interests are anchored in stroke and neurovascular illnesses, neurophysiology and neuromuscular disorders, and neuroimmunology - a spectrum that includes multiple sclerosis. As the SPHERE Translational Research Fellow in Neurovascular Medicine at the Ingham Institute of Applied Medical Research, Dr Blair leads groundbreaking research utilising cutting-edge imaging techniques for stroke and neurovascular diseases. His expertise includes high-resolution mag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) and FDG-PET/CT. He is also deeply involved as an Associate Investigator for over 10 clinical trials and has an impressive portfolio of over 70 publications. In 2020, he showcased his research at major international conventions in the US and Europe. Dr Blair is committed to enhancing patients' comprehension of their neurological conditions.
